Finance Review — Licensing Dispute. The Corvalux matter concerning the Pellin patent suite continues. Accrued legal fees stand at 640k; provision raised to 1.4m on counsel's advice. Mediation scheduled next quarter. Royalty payments to escrow continue, preserving cash clarity. No revenue recognition impact to date. Our contingency strategy should talks fail is summarised below.

confidential, kagep-kahof: Druokax Systems plans to lower the Ulaath list price by 53 percent in March.

MEMO — Veltrane Systems, Receiving, Dorsey Point site

Six Quillax M4 demo units are being returned from the Harwick trade floor. All were powered down and factory-reset by the field team; do not re-image before intake inspection. Log serial plates against the loan sheet and flag any missing styli. Cartons are marked DEMO RETURN in orange. Expected arrival Thursday morning via courier. Storage bay 3 is reserved. The confidential hand-over instruction for the courier follows below.

courier memo of kagug-yajof: the belys wenok courier leaves the praix ledger at gate 8902 under passcode 669584

## Migration step 4: Enable batched resolvers

The Ferngate API previously resolved nested author fields one query per node, which is the N+1 behavior this release removes. After merging, all list resolvers route through the new dataloader layer; reviewers should confirm no resolver bypasses it with a direct repository call. Batch sizing and cache lifetimes are tunable, and poor choices can reintroduce latency spikes under load. The loader must be started with the configuration values below.

settings of tagef-bawif:
DRUIX_HOST=druix.zemvarlabs.internal
DRUIX_PORT=8000

Step 4: Reconfigure the Harbormere partner SFTP drop

After upgrading to the v3 plugin API, plugins no longer read drop-folder settings from their own manifests. Harbormere now injects these centrally, so remove any hardcoded paths and polling intervals from your plugin. The values your plugin will receive at runtime are shown below.

deployment values, tafof-taduf:
pelius:
  pin: 6508
  tenant: praiel
  seal: seal_4e33a2f4
  metrics_host: metrics.pelius.plorvagrid.corp
  standby_team: druix
  escalation: juldor-norius
  nonce: 5db598